What are the common prostate problems that can affect sex?
One common problem is prostatitis, which is inflammation of the prostate. It can cause pain during ejaculation and discomfort during sexual intercourse. Another is an enlarged prostate (benign prostatic hyperplasia), which may lead to difficulty in getting or maintaining an erection.

What are the causes and treatments of urinary incontinence in women?
The main causes of urinary incontinence in women might be childbirth, aging, obesity, or nerve problems. As for treatments, it depends on the type and severity. Options include lifestyle changes like losing weight, doing kegel exercises, and sometimes using pessaries or undergoing surgical procedures.

The Role of the Pineal Gland in Science Fiction
In science fiction, the pineal gland is often depicted as a sort of 'third eye' or a gateway to enhanced mental abilities. For example, in some stories, characters with a more developed pineal gland can access psychic powers like telepathy or precognition. It gives a scientific - sounding basis for extraordinary human abilities that are otherwise considered supernatural.
